Flagstone Sealing in Tacoma, WA
Flagstone sealing services involve applying a protective coating to flagstone surfaces, such as walkways, patios, or garden paths, to enhance their durability and appearance. This process helps prevent damage from water penetration, staining, and weathering, ensuring the stone maintains its natural look over time. Property owners often request flagstone sealing to preserve the aesthetic appeal of outdoor spaces, reduce maintenance needs, and extend the lifespan of their stone features.
Before requesting flagstone sealing, property owners typically want to understand the current condition of their stone surfaces, including any existing damage or staining. It's also important to consider the type of sealer used, as different products offer varying levels of protection and finish.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airs, is usually necessary to achieve the best results. Clarifying these details can help ensure the sealing process meets the specific needs of the project and maintains the natural beauty of the flagstone.

Flagstone Sealing Questions
What is flagstone sealing? Flagstone sealing involves applying a protective coating to enhance the durability and appearance of flagstone surfaces like patios and walkways.
Why should flagstone be sealed? Sealing helps prevent stains, water damage, and moss growth, keeping flagstone looking its best longer.
How often should flagstone be resealed? Typically, resealing is recommended every few years to maintain protection and appearance.
What types of sealers are used for flagstone? Penetrating sealers and surface sealers are common options, chosen based on the desired look and level of protection.
